• MOD DESCRIPTION •
This mod provides players (and NPCs) with expanded freedom and realism when creating a new empire. It offers increased trait points, ethics, and civic picks. Whether you're looking to craft a unique civilization or simply experiment with different combinations, this mod enhances the Stellaris empire-building experience by increasing the diversity of alien species and ecosystems, improving biological realism.

Vanilla Values:
- ETHOS_MAX_POINTS: 3
- GOVERNMENT_CIVIC_POINTS_BASE: 2
- Machine Trait Points: 1
- Biological Trait Points: 2
- Max Machine Traits: 5
- Max Biological Traits: 5

Standard (Mod Default Preset) Values:
- ETHOS_MAX_POINTS: 5
- GOVERNMENT_CIVIC_POINTS_BASE: 5
- Machine Trait Points: 4
- Biological Trait Points: 5
- Max Machine Traits: 8
- Max Biological Traits: 8

Custom Values:
With flexScript[github.com], you can freely customize these values to your preference.

• WHAT'S NEW IN THE FLEX EDITION? •
The FLEX EDITION introduces a revolutionary way to tweak the mod's settings. With the flexScript[github.com] (FS), you can:
  • Set the mod to vanilla default values.
  • Use the standard or beast presets (similar to the previous STANDARD and BEAST editions).
  • Fully customize the points and picks to your liking.
  • Prepare MPP for server gameplay.
FS is open source and was developed in Python. You can easily check its code in our GitHub repository.

• HOW TO USE THE FLEXSCRIPT •
  1. Download the latest release from the Releases Page[github.com].
  2. Follow the instructions in the Readme.md file at flexScript[github.com].
  3. Run the script and follow the on-screen prompts to customize your mod settings.

• HOW TO UPDATE MPP •
With FS, you don’t have to wait for the mod to be updated—you can update it yourself whenever Stellaris gets a new version. That’s one of the main reasons this script was developed. Just follow these steps:
  1. Run FS and let it check all folders and files to ensure everything is in place.
  2. Choose option 6: UPDATE. If you're in SERVER MODE, deactivate it before proceeding.
  3. Wait for the update to complete: This may take a few moments, so please be patient.

• WARNING •
Please note that this mod also alters the picks and point limits for NPC Empires. This is not intended to function as a Cheat Mod. Instead, these changes enhance the diversity of traits across different species and empires, both player-created and AI-controlled. This affects game balance and may make the game harder or easier depending on the species you create.

• COMPATIBILITY •
This mod is compatible with Stellaris 3.11+. The STANDARD, BEAST, and LITE versions are no longer maintained. Instead, all features have been integrated into this FLEX EDITION for a more streamlined and user-friendly experience, making maintenance easier and more autonomous.

• KNOWN ISSUES •
  • Occasionally, running FS might trigger Windows Defender due to its interaction with mod files and Stellaris installation. Rest assured, this script is safe, and you can verify its harmless nature by checking the code on our GitHub repository, it's open-source.
  • Some mod incompatibilities may arise when using other mods that modify trait points, ethics, or civics. More details are provided in the Compatibility section above.
  • There's a known issue with the "Tactical Algorithms" civic for machine empires that may prevent leader trading. We are investigating this and working on a fix. In the meantime, if you encounter this issue, avoid using this civic if you need to trade leaders.
